ALLTEL and Ford Credit Team to Develop Finance Software
9 December 1998
ALLTEL and Ford Credit Team to Develop Automotive Finance SoftwareLITTLE ROCK, Ark., Dec. 8 -- ALLTEL announced today that it has formed a strategic alliance with Ford Credit to develop market-leading systems for automotive finance. ALLTEL and Ford Credit jointly will develop application software to support retail, lease and wholesale financing. The applications that will be developed from the multi-year agreement represent a significant expansion of ALLTEL's current relationship with PRIMUS, Ford Credit's automotive financial services subsidiary that serves dealers and customers outside the Ford franchise system, and with Fairlane Credit, Ford Credit's specialty finance affiliate. These applications will be designed for high-volume, low-cost operations to meet the demands of a rapidly growing market. At the heart of this development is ALLTEL's Advanced Loan System (ALS), a retail lending application chosen by more of the top 100 U.S. banks than any other single vendor application. ALS allows financial organizations to create loan products and introduce them quickly. The ALS application will be further enhanced with additional specific parameters and modules designed for the automotive financing industry, including adding specific functionality to support automotive lease processing. Both ALLTEL and Ford Credit are committing significant resources to this project to ensure that results will provide state-of-the-art flexibility and functionality in financing and leasing. Ford Credit is the world's largest company dedicated to automotive finance, providing financial services to dealers and more than 8 million automotive retail customers in 36 countries. A wholly owned subsidiary of Ford Motor Company , it has assets of more than $140 billion in its worldwide-managed operations. ALLTEL Information Services, with customers in 48 countries, provides information processing management, outsourcing services and application software to the financial, mortgage and telecommunications industries.
